Casting at PaperMap

Casting is thoughtful, intentional, and ensemble-first. We will hold public auditions, with roles prioritized by those who audition during the public in-person or video timeframe.

Roles are assigned based on:

  • ensemble balance and chemistry

  • readiness and growth opportunities

  • the needs of the story

  • the overall health of the cast

Every performer has meaningful stage time and real responsibility. There are no “background-only” roles. This is a shared creative effort.
